On October 10, World Mental Health Day is celebrated. This year’s motto, Mental Health is a Universal Human Right, seeks to improve knowledge, raise awareness and promote measures that promote and protect the mental health of all as a universal human right.

According to WHO data, one in eight people in the world suffers from a mental health problem. Mental disorders affect one in seven adolescents worldwide, and depression is emerging as the leading cause of illness and disability among adolescents. Suicide is the second cause of death among people between 15 and 29 years of age. People with serious mental health disorders die prematurely from preventable physical illnesses.

Good mental health allows us to face challenges, relate to others and enjoy our lives. Mental health is vital and deserves to be recognized and respected.

On the occasion of this day, the Aragon Mental Health Federation and the Aragonese Association for Mental Health (ASAPME) organized an awareness day in the Crown Room of the Pignatelli Building, where a manifesto defending the right to well-being was read. and to participation in a society that respects mental health, that offers trust instead of discrimination and understanding instead of exclusion. The ASAPME Aragón 2023 awards were also presented to the Sesé Foundation and the journalist Ana Esteban.
